117 Y
A GREEN AND RUSSET JADE ‘CRANE
AND PEACHES’ GROUP
Qing Dynasty
The recumbent crane with the head arched
around to the rear, grasping a fruiting peach
stem in is mouth, the pale green stone with
russet inclusions, hongmu stand.
8.2cm (3 1/4in) long (2).

118
A GREEN AND RUSSET SKINNED JADE
CAT GROUP
Qing Dynasty
The recumbent feline playing with a mouse
between its forepaws, the grey-green stone
with creamy mottling and russet inclusions.
6.5cm (2 5/8in) long

119
TWO PALE GREEN AND RUSSET JADE
CARVINGS
Ming or later
Comprising: a jade group carved in open
work with two birds on a lingzhi branch;
together with an uncarved jade disc with one
side carved in relief with chilong and young
facing each other and grasping a lingzhi
spray. The biggest: 8cm (3 1/8in) long (2).
